Whitehall must improve its oversight of council finances after auditors were unable to sign off the public sector's accounts for the first time, MPs have said. 

A Public Accounts Committee (PAC) report said it was ‘concerned that the Ministry of Housing, Communities and Local Government does not have sufficient oversight of local government to foresee issues and intervene where appropriate'.
